[<prev] [next>] [<thread-prev] [day] [month] [year] [list]
Message-Id: <1311429944-6463-1-git-send-email-vapier@gentoo.org>
Date: Sat, 23 Jul 2011 10:05:44 -0400
From: Mike Frysinger <vapier@...too.org>
To: Linus Torvalds <torvalds@...ux-foundation.org>
Cc: linux-kernel@...r.kernel.org,
uclinux-dist-devel@...ckfin.uclinux.org
Subject: Pull request blackfin.git (for-linus branch)
The following changes since commit 8e204874db000928e37199c2db82b7eb8966cc3c:
Merge branch 'x86-vdso-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ip (2011-07-22 17:05:15 -0700)
are available in the git repository at:
git://git.kernel.org/pub/scm/linux/kernel/git/vapier/blackfin.git for-linus
Mathias Krause (1):
Blackfin: exec: remove redundant set_fs(USER_DS)
Mike Frysinger (39):
Blackfin: convert to kbuild asm-generic support
Blackfin: net2272: move pin setup to boards files
Blackfin: boards: clean up redundant/dead spi resources
Blackfin: SMP: optimize start up code a bit
Blackfin: time: replace magic numbers with defines
Blackfin: optimize double fault boot checking
Blackfin: convert to asm-generic/mutex-dec.h for all systems
Blackfin: debug-mmrs: fix typo in single dmac setup
Blackfin: debug-mmrs: disable PERIPHERAL_MAP for IMDMA channels
Blackfin: bf561-ezkit: change parallel flash from M to Y in defconfig
Blackfin: update anomaly lists to latest public info
Blackfin: gptimers: add group structure for hardware register layout
Blackfin: debug-mmrs: prevent macro arg from expanding
Blackfin: debug-mmrs: use new gptimer_group layout to simplify code
Blackfin: gptimers: use register structs from common header
Blackfin: gptimers: use bfin read/write helpers
Blackfin: gptimers: add enable/disable by timer id
Blackfin: pwm: implement linux/pwm.h API
Blackfin: convert unicode space gremlins
Blackfin: gpio: punt unused GPIO_# defines
Blackfin: bf54x: constify pint register array
Blackfin: bf54x: tweak MMR pint names
Blackfin: bf54x: switch to common pint MMR struct
Blackfin: debug-mmrs: generalize pint logic
Blackfin: dpmc: bind to MMR names and not CPUs
Blackfin: gpio/ints: generalize pint logic
Blackfin: dpmc: optimize SIC_IWR programming a little
Blackfin: dpmc: omit RETE/RETN when hibernating
Blackfin: dpmc: relocate hibernate helper macros
Blackfin: dpmc: do not save/restore EVT0/EVT1/EVT4 when hibernating
Blackfin: dpmc: optimize hibernate/resume path
Blackfin: bf538: pull gpio/port logic out of core hibernate paths
Blackfin: dpmc: don't save/restore scratch registers
Blackfin: dpmc: optimize SDRAM programming slightly
Blackfin: bf54x: fix GPIO resume code
Blackfin: bf51x: fix alternative portmux options
Blackfin: bf526: restrict reboot workaround to 0.0 silicon
Blackfin: SMP: punt unused atomic_test_mask helper
Blackfin: spi-docs: further clarify GPIO CS behavior with various modes
Scott Jiang (1):
Blackfin: boards: fix pcm device name
Steven Miao (1):
Blackfin: make sure percpu section is aligned in XIP builds
Steven Rostedt (1):
Blackfin: irqs: do not trace arch_local_{*,irq_*} functions
Documentation/blackfin/bfin-spi-notes.txt | 2 +
arch/blackfin/Kconfig | 10 +
arch/blackfin/configs/BF561-EZKIT_defconfig | 8 +-
arch/blackfin/include/asm/Kbuild | 43 +
arch/blackfin/include/asm/atomic.h | 13 +-
arch/blackfin/include/asm/auxvec.h | 1 -
arch/blackfin/include/asm/bitsperlong.h | 1 -
arch/blackfin/include/asm/blackfin.h | 6 +-
arch/blackfin/include/asm/bugs.h | 1 -
arch/blackfin/include/asm/cputime.h | 1 -
arch/blackfin/include/asm/current.h | 1 -
arch/blackfin/include/asm/device.h | 1 -
arch/blackfin/include/asm/div64.h | 1 -
arch/blackfin/include/asm/dpmc.h | 27 -
arch/blackfin/include/asm/emergency-restart.h | 1 -
arch/blackfin/include/asm/errno.h | 1 -
arch/blackfin/include/asm/fb.h | 1 -
arch/blackfin/include/asm/futex.h | 1 -
arch/blackfin/include/asm/gpio.h | 64 +--
arch/blackfin/include/asm/gptimers.h | 19 +
arch/blackfin/include/asm/hw_irq.h | 1 -
arch/blackfin/include/asm/ioctl.h | 1 -
arch/blackfin/include/asm/ipcbuf.h | 1 -
arch/blackfin/include/asm/irq_regs.h | 1 -
arch/blackfin/include/asm/irqflags.h | 42 +-
arch/blackfin/include/asm/kdebug.h | 1 -
arch/blackfin/include/asm/kmap_types.h | 1 -
arch/blackfin/include/asm/local.h | 1 -
arch/blackfin/include/asm/local64.h | 1 -
arch/blackfin/include/asm/mman.h | 1 -
arch/blackfin/include/asm/module.h | 8 +-
arch/blackfin/include/asm/msgbuf.h | 1 -
arch/blackfin/include/asm/mutex.h | 77 +--
arch/blackfin/include/asm/page.h | 8 +-
arch/blackfin/include/asm/param.h | 1 -
arch/blackfin/include/asm/pda.h | 10 +
arch/blackfin/include/asm/percpu.h | 1 -
arch/blackfin/include/asm/pgalloc.h | 1 -
arch/blackfin/include/asm/resource.h | 1 -
arch/blackfin/include/asm/scatterlist.h | 6 -
arch/blackfin/include/asm/sections.h | 8 +-
arch/blackfin/include/asm/sembuf.h | 1 -
arch/blackfin/include/asm/serial.h | 1 -
arch/blackfin/include/asm/setup.h | 1 -
arch/blackfin/include/asm/shmbuf.h | 1 -
arch/blackfin/include/asm/shmparam.h | 1 -
arch/blackfin/include/asm/sigcontext.h | 8 +-
arch/blackfin/include/asm/socket.h | 1 -
arch/blackfin/include/asm/sockios.h | 1 -
arch/blackfin/include/asm/spinlock.h | 8 +-
arch/blackfin/include/asm/statfs.h | 1 -
arch/blackfin/include/asm/termbits.h | 1 -
arch/blackfin/include/asm/termios.h | 1 -
arch/blackfin/include/asm/topology.h | 1 -
arch/blackfin/include/asm/types.h | 1 -
arch/blackfin/include/asm/ucontext.h | 1 -
arch/blackfin/include/asm/unaligned.h | 1 -
arch/blackfin/include/asm/user.h | 1 -
arch/blackfin/include/asm/xor.h | 1 -
arch/blackfin/kernel/Makefile | 1 +
arch/blackfin/kernel/asm-offsets.c | 10 +
arch/blackfin/kernel/bfin_gpio.c | 26 +-
arch/blackfin/kernel/debug-mmrs.c | 109 ++-
arch/blackfin/kernel/gptimers.c | 93 +--
arch/blackfin/kernel/process.c | 1 -
arch/blackfin/kernel/pwm.c | 100 +++
arch/blackfin/kernel/reboot.c | 4 +-
arch/blackfin/kernel/setup.c | 16 +-
arch/blackfin/kernel/time.c | 4 +-
arch/blackfin/kernel/vmlinux.lds.S | 1 +
arch/blackfin/mach-bf518/Kconfig | 78 ++-
arch/blackfin/mach-bf518/boards/ezbrd.c | 59 --
arch/blackfin/mach-bf518/boards/tcm-bf518.c | 47 -
arch/blackfin/mach-bf518/include/mach/anomaly.h | 24 +-
arch/blackfin/mach-bf518/include/mach/portmux.h | 54 +-
arch/blackfin/mach-bf527/boards/ad7160eval.c | 19 -
arch/blackfin/mach-bf527/boards/cm_bf527.c | 55 --
arch/blackfin/mach-bf527/boards/ezbrd.c | 62 --
arch/blackfin/mach-bf527/boards/ezkit.c | 98 +--
arch/blackfin/mach-bf527/boards/tll6527m.c | 70 --
arch/blackfin/mach-bf527/include/mach/anomaly.h | 34 +-
arch/blackfin/mach-bf533/boards/H8606.c | 28 -
arch/blackfin/mach-bf533/boards/blackstamp.c | 10 -
arch/blackfin/mach-bf533/boards/cm_bf533.c | 29 -
arch/blackfin/mach-bf533/boards/ezkit.c | 36 -
arch/blackfin/mach-bf533/boards/ip0x.c | 1 -
arch/blackfin/mach-bf533/boards/stamp.c | 78 +-
arch/blackfin/mach-bf533/include/mach/anomaly.h | 19 +-
arch/blackfin/mach-bf537/boards/cm_bf537e.c | 51 +-
arch/blackfin/mach-bf537/boards/cm_bf537u.c | 63 +-
arch/blackfin/mach-bf537/boards/dnp5370.c | 2 -
arch/blackfin/mach-bf537/boards/minotaur.c | 2 -
arch/blackfin/mach-bf537/boards/pnav10.c | 38 -
arch/blackfin/mach-bf537/boards/stamp.c | 176 ++---
arch/blackfin/mach-bf537/boards/tcm_bf537.c | 51 +-
arch/blackfin/mach-bf537/include/mach/anomaly.h | 34 +-
arch/blackfin/mach-bf538/boards/ezkit.c | 25 -
arch/blackfin/mach-bf538/ext-gpio.c | 37 +-
arch/blackfin/mach-bf538/include/mach/anomaly.h | 38 +-
arch/blackfin/mach-bf538/include/mach/gpio.h | 3 +
arch/blackfin/mach-bf548/boards/cm_bf548.c | 15 -
arch/blackfin/mach-bf548/boards/ezkit.c | 32 -
arch/blackfin/mach-bf548/include/mach/anomaly.h | 220 +++---
arch/blackfin/mach-bf548/include/mach/gpio.h | 2 +
arch/blackfin/mach-bf548/include/mach/irq.h | 2 +-
arch/blackfin/mach-bf561/boards/acvilon.c | 9 -
arch/blackfin/mach-bf561/boards/cm_bf561.c | 58 +-
arch/blackfin/mach-bf561/boards/ezkit.c | 41 +-
arch/blackfin/mach-bf561/include/mach/anomaly.h | 132 ++--
arch/blackfin/mach-bf561/include/mach/gpio.h | 6 +-
arch/blackfin/mach-bf561/secondary.S | 152 ++---
arch/blackfin/mach-common/dpmc_modes.S | 1016 +++++++++++++----------
arch/blackfin/mach-common/head.S | 36 +-
arch/blackfin/mach-common/ints-priority.c | 41 +-
arch/blackfin/mach-common/smp.c | 17 +-
115 files changed, 1735 insertions(+), 2138 deletions(-)
delete mode 100644 arch/blackfin/include/asm/auxvec.h
delete mode 100644 arch/blackfin/include/asm/bitsperlong.h
delete mode 100644 arch/blackfin/include/asm/bugs.h
delete mode 100644 arch/blackfin/include/asm/cputime.h
delete mode 100644 arch/blackfin/include/asm/current.h
delete mode 100644 arch/blackfin/include/asm/device.h
delete mode 100644 arch/blackfin/include/asm/div64.h
delete mode 100644 arch/blackfin/include/asm/emergency-restart.h
delete mode 100644 arch/blackfin/include/asm/errno.h
delete mode 100644 arch/blackfin/include/asm/fb.h
delete mode 100644 arch/blackfin/include/asm/futex.h
delete mode 100644 arch/blackfin/include/asm/hw_irq.h
delete mode 100644 arch/blackfin/include/asm/ioctl.h
delete mode 100644 arch/blackfin/include/asm/ipcbuf.h
delete mode 100644 arch/blackfin/include/asm/irq_regs.h
delete mode 100644 arch/blackfin/include/asm/kdebug.h
delete mode 100644 arch/blackfin/include/asm/kmap_types.h
delete mode 100644 arch/blackfin/include/asm/local.h
delete mode 100644 arch/blackfin/include/asm/local64.h
delete mode 100644 arch/blackfin/include/asm/mman.h
delete mode 100644 arch/blackfin/include/asm/msgbuf.h
delete mode 100644 arch/blackfin/include/asm/param.h
delete mode 100644 arch/blackfin/include/asm/percpu.h
delete mode 100644 arch/blackfin/include/asm/pgalloc.h
delete mode 100644 arch/blackfin/include/asm/resource.h
delete mode 100644 arch/blackfin/include/asm/scatterlist.h
delete mode 100644 arch/blackfin/include/asm/sembuf.h
delete mode 100644 arch/blackfin/include/asm/serial.h
delete mode 100644 arch/blackfin/include/asm/setup.h
delete mode 100644 arch/blackfin/include/asm/shmbuf.h
delete mode 100644 arch/blackfin/include/asm/shmparam.h
delete mode 100644 arch/blackfin/include/asm/socket.h
delete mode 100644 arch/blackfin/include/asm/sockios.h
delete mode 100644 arch/blackfin/include/asm/statfs.h
delete mode 100644 arch/blackfin/include/asm/termbits.h
delete mode 100644 arch/blackfin/include/asm/termios.h
delete mode 100644 arch/blackfin/include/asm/topology.h
delete mode 100644 arch/blackfin/include/asm/types.h
delete mode 100644 arch/blackfin/include/asm/ucontext.h
delete mode 100644 arch/blackfin/include/asm/unaligned.h
delete mode 100644 arch/blackfin/include/asm/user.h
delete mode 100644 arch/blackfin/include/asm/xor.h
create mode 100644 arch/blackfin/kernel/pwm.c
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ists